Head of Product - AI

·Germany
HybridFull-timeProduct ManagementSoftware DevelopmentHR tech

Lead the product vision for AI-powered, autonomous features across a workforce management platform. Own customer discovery, roadmap, and cross-functional alignment, driving measurable business value for enterprise clients.

Responsibilities

  • Lead structured customer discovery programs with enterprise clients, including executive interviews, on-site job shadowing, and quantitative surveys to surface deep pain points and unmet needs.
  • Synthesize findings into crisp problem statements, opportunity assessments, and validated hypotheses for organizational action.
  • Build and maintain a living customer insight repository tracking pain points, use case priorities, and willingness-to-pay signals across segments.
  • Partner with customer success and sales to continuously harvest real-world feedback from pilot deployments and live agentic features.
  • Define and own the multi-horizon roadmap for agentic AI features, from near-term human-in-the-loop capabilities to longer-range autonomous workflow orchestration.
  • Translate customer pain points and strategic bets into a prioritized, outcomes-driven backlog with clear success metrics (adoption, time saved, error reduction, NPS).
  • Balance innovation ambition with enterprise realities: compliance, data privacy (GDPR), auditability, and change management for large hourly worker populations.
  • Stay at the forefront of LLM, agent frameworks, and WFM-adjacent AI to inform build, partner, or acquire decisions.
  • Act as the strategic interface between C-suite sponsors, engineering, product leads, UX, legal, and go-to-market teams, keeping all parties aligned on priorities and trade-offs.
  • Lead quarterly roadmap reviews with executive stakeholders.
  • Represent the product externally at customer advisory boards, analyst briefings, and industry events as a thought leader on agentic WFM.
  • Influence without direct authority, building consensus across competing priorities in a matrixed, fast-moving organization.
  • Partner closely with engineering and design to move from discovery through definition, build, and launch using an agile delivery model.
  • Define clear acceptance criteria and launch readiness gates for agentic features, including safety, hallucination, and escalation handling requirements.
  • Drive go-to-market collaboration with Product Marketing and Sales Enablement to land feature launches with measurable commercial impact.
  • Monitor post-launch performance against KPIs, iterate rapidly based on telemetry and customer feedback loops.
  • Mentor other product owners and contribute to the maturity of the product culture and AI product practices.
  • Communicate complex AI concepts clearly to non-technical stakeholders, bridging the gap between technical feasibility and commercial value.
  • Champion a customer-centric, evidence-based product culture that resists feature theatre and focuses on outcomes.
  • Partner with the Pricing Manager to define and validate monetization models for agentic AI features, evaluating usage-based, outcome-based, and tiered subscription approaches.
  • Translate customer value metrics into pricing anchors and willingness-to-pay hypotheses grounded in discovery data.
  • Contribute to packaging decisions, defining what is bundled in the core platform versus positioned as a premium AI add-on.
  • Track pricing performance post-launch, monitoring attach rates, expansion revenue, and price sensitivity signals, feeding insights back into pricing strategy.

Requirements

  • 10+ years of B2B SaaS product management experience, with at least 2 years shipping AI or ML-powered features to enterprise customers.
  • Demonstrated track record of running structured customer discovery programs and translating insights into shipped, measurable product improvements.
  • Experience building and managing multi-horizon roadmaps in complex, multi-stakeholder environments.
  • Strong command of agile delivery and modern product management frameworks.
  • Proven ability to influence and align senior stakeholders without direct authority.
  • Comfort with technical AI concepts: LLMs, agent architectures, RAG, tool use, orchestration, as a product leader making confident product decisions.

Nice to have

  • Domain expertise in Workforce Management, HR tech, or enterprise scheduling software.
  • Experience with agentic AI product patterns (multi-step task agents, human-in-the-loop escalation, autonomous workflow orchestration).
  • Familiarity with EU AI Act and GDPR implications for enterprise AI products.
  • Experience in a public B2B SaaS company or scale-up with enterprise sales motions.
